  2. Overview The flange is a method of connecting two pipes, valves, pumps & other equipment in order to form a perfect piping system. Also, it provides an easy access for cleaning, modification & inspection. From automotive flanges manufacturers to customize flanges exporters, a wide range of flanges is available in India. They are generally welded or screwed.   The most used types of flanges are according to ASME B16.5 are the welding neck, slip-on, socket weld & lap joint, threaded & blind flanges.   3. Welding Neck Flange It is easy to recognize at the long tapered hub, generally, it goes gradually over to wall thickness of a pipe or fitting. It provides an important reinforcement for different usage in different applications involving high pressure & elevated temperature. From flange thickness, the wall thickness may be affected by the taper that is extremely beneficial. SLIDE 04 SAINIFLANGE

  4. SLIP-ON FLANGE Under internal pressure, the strength is in the order of two-thirds of that of welding neck flanges. Plus, their life under fatigue is about 1/3 that of the latter. The disadvantage of this type of flange is that the principle is always a pipe must be welded then just a fitting.   5. Socket Weld Flange These were initially developed for use on small in size high pressure. The static strength is equal to slip-on flanges, but their fatigue strength 50% greater than double welded slip-on flanges. The purpose of the flange is to reduce the residual stress at the root of the weld, which could occur while solidification of weld material. The disadvantage of this flange is right the gap. The crack between the pipe & flange can give corrosion issues.  SAINIFLANGE
